    Dear support,

    since a week we receive SEPA payments from customers that are trying to pay with iDeal

    I never activated SEPA payments and stripe support confirmed that the request is coming from WooCommerce.

    I don’t see a Direct SEPA payment method at checkout, I’m quite confused.

    I don’t understand how they’re using that method, and it takes days to transfer the money so I’m not sure that these orders will be actually paid.

    How can we troubleshoot this?

    Hello there,

    I am sorry this flow feels confusing. When a customer pays using iDEAL and saves it for future payments, it is stored as a SEPA payment. Then, when they use it to do complete another order, it is displayed as SEPA. You can read more about this behavior on this Stripe page. And you can read more about the SEPA debit behavior here. On this page you can see:

    SEPA Direct Debit?is a?delayed notification payment method, which means that funds are not immediately available after payment. A payment typically takes?5 business days?to arrive in your account.

    @wesleyjrosa as a merchant, we can’t work with a payment method that takes 2 weeks to transfer money.

    SEPA debit is great for subscriptions, but not for one-time orders. Not even if they are returning customers.

    The order stays on-hold until is paid, how can we tell the customer to wait 1-2 weeks before we process the order?

    And I haven’t seen this behavior in any other webshop. iDeal is always a one-time, instant transition.
